               TITLE 28--JUDICIARY AND JUDICIAL PROCEDURE
 
                     PART VI--PARTICULAR PROCEEDINGS
 
              CHAPTER 163--FINES, PENALTIES AND FORFEITURES
 
Sec. 2463. Property taken under revenue law not repleviable

    All property taken or detained under any revenue law of the United 
States shall not be repleviable, but shall be deemed to be in the 
custody of the law and subject only to the orders and decrees of the 
courts of the United States having jurisdiction thereof.

(June 25, 1948, ch. 646, 62 Stat. 974.)


                      Historical and Revision Notes

    Based on title 28, U.S.C., 1940 ed., Sec. 747 (R.S. Sec. 934).
    Changes were made in phraseology.
